Establishing an Effective Online Store

What approach can a business use to establish an online store that stands out among numerous competitors? To begin with, the design must be visually appealing and user-friendly, ensuring a seamless navigation experience. A mobile-responsive layout is crucial, as a significant number of consumers shop via smartphones. In addition, high-quality product images and detailed descriptions enhance credibility and can influence purchasing decisions.

Additionally, integrating customer reviews and testimonials establishes trust among potential buyers. Enhancing the checkout process by limiting steps and offering multiple payment options can decrease cart abandonment rates. Additionally, clear policies regarding shipping, returns, and customer service should be prominently displayed to ease buyer concerns.

Last but not least, incorporating powerful search functionality permits users to find products quickly, while personalized recommendations can improve the shopping experience. By concentrating on these features, a business can develop an online store that not only appeals to customers but also encourages repeat visits and loyalty.

Evaluating Output and Growth Metrics

Tracking key performance metrics is crucial for ecommerce businesses aiming to enhance their strategies and drive success. By analyzing essential data points such as conversion rates, average order value, and customer acquisition costs, businesses can obtain critical intelligence into their operational efficiency. Measuring metrics like website traffic and bounce rates enables pinpointing user engagement levels, while tracking customer lifetime value (CLV) empowers companies to gauge long-term profitability.

Additionally, leveraging tools like Google Analytics enables real-time data analysis, facilitating informed decision-making. Detecting trends and patterns in sales data can result in targeted marketing efforts and inventory management improvements. Ongoing evaluation of these metrics ensures that businesses can adapt to market changes and consumer behavior effectively. Ultimately, a comprehensive understanding of performance and growth metrics empowers ecommerce companies to enhance their offerings and achieve sustainable growth in a competitive online landscape.
